1972 50w lead. This one was originally a Bass circuit; someone made it a lead but used orange drops and other non original parts; not much crunch to speak of. I looked at my 72 100w and sourced the same yellow chicklets and mustards, and used the same values as EVHs 68 including the fat caps and now it gains up nicely above 2 on the T channel. Original transformers, clean headshell. Did have a Master on the back at one point but removed before I got it. I’m asking less than market because of the hole on the back, and only one input works, the top L… Turns out that both Treble/Rhythm inputs are combined which is why the others don't work...you can run only the T side with the bass side on 0, and vice/versa. So no need for a small cable to link them since they already are... you can blend them by twisting the vol knobs. I’ll include 2 inputs as I had planned on swapping them in. Has 2 GT EL 34, and JJ pre. I’ll send 2 more 34s with it.
